Transaction 963b445aff92995ba4c29b0b07cb93018ed8d38c5f9486320350e2fdb5f61e73

1 Input
2 Outputs
  • 963b445aff92995ba4c29b0b07cb93018ed8d38c5f9486320350e2fdb5f61e73:0
  • value  535598564
    address  38AxRGaGGYnsdRoLb8zrrrMEXmF91uSqst
  • 963b445aff92995ba4c29b0b07cb93018ed8d38c5f9486320350e2fdb5f61e73:1
  • value  25797606
    address  3MeWr4fDhEiVcN35Apmi68zoDqDDmHn3mz